Shai-Hulud's Reach Just Grew to 469 Credential Locations. Here's What That Means

last 60 dispatches · spectrum

In early August, GitGuardian researchers found that a recent Shai-Hulud infostealer worm variant had evolved to scan for credentials across 469 locations across developer environments,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) tooling, cloud configurations, and even AI tool configs. Earlier variants of the infostealer worm only checked 189 paths. The jump says a lot. …
